Police car dragged man's body for blocks

IRONTON, Ohio -- When Ironton Police Officer Richard Fouts arrived for duty Saturday night, he noticed something wedged beneath his car.

Fouts had run over Guy Thomas, 46, and dragged the man's body for six-tenths of a mile, apparently without noticing.

"It's hard to believe a cop could drag somebody that far and not realize it," the dead man's nephew, Juan Thomas Jr., said yesterday. "An officer is supposed to be totally aware of his surroundings. … It's not possible at all."
